Job Title: Patient Services RepresentativeLocation: Ephrata,
PAJob DescriptionWith a customer service focus, the Patient
Services Representative will greet, check-in patients, oversee all
patient demographic, insurance card scanning, have required
paperwork filled out/signed, collection of necessary account
balances and procedure visits.Essential Functions:Reasonable
acc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ities
to perform the essential functions:Greet patients and visitors in a
prompt, courteous and helpful mannerGenerating patient care forms
and monitoring them for completeness and legibility. Forwarding
forms to correct departments / support staffPrepare and distribute
appropriate paperwork to the patient for signature and
completionContact billing for inquiries from the patientMonitoring
patient wait times. Alerting appropriate staff when wait times are
excessiveMaintain patient waiting area. Maintain cleanliness of
waiting areaStocking stations when requiredVerify demographic and
insurance information and update as necessary in EMRVerify patient
paperwork for completion and scan documents, insurance card(s) and
photo identification into EMRVerify current information for
upcoming appointments.Complete daily insurance verification for
patient appointmentsScanning of patient medical documents for
Intake, as directed or requiredComplete and verify meaningful use
fields are completed for complianceCollect appropriate copays and
Medical Records feesObtain HIPAA release documentation,
verification of identity for Medical RecordsUpdate insurance if
missing or inaccurate from EMR system and report to
billing.Scheduling follow-up appointments and tests, helping
patients secure referrals when necessaryCoordinating the delivery
of internal services such as patient x-ray disks, forms, test
results, etc.Analyzing physician orders and charge slips to
determine patient financial and insurance carrier mandated
responsibilitiesKeeping records of money collected. Balancing
receipts at the end of shiftOther duties as assigned.Required
Qualifications:A high school diploma/GED is required.A minimum of
one (1) year of customer service experience is required.Preferred
Education and Experience:Medical background preferred.Associate's
and/or a Bachelor's Degree is preferred.Minimum one year of EPIC
experience.Strong computer skills.Excellent communication
skills.Travel:May be required to travel to all five office
